The Purpose of Bible Study

Bible study is a transformative endeavor that extends far beyond the act of reading words on a page. It involves delving into the depths of God’s Word, seeking to grasp its profound truths, and allowing those truths to shape our lives. It is through this intentional study that we begin to uncover the richness and relevance of Scripture for our daily existence.

Gaining a Deeper Understanding

Bible study allows us to move beyond surface-level familiarity with the text and venture into a deeper understanding of God’s Word. It invites us to explore the historical context, cultural nuances, and literary techniques employed within the Scriptures. By doing so, we unravel layers of meaning, unlocking the timeless wisdom that can guide our thoughts, actions, and decisions.

Deepening Faith

Bible study is a gateway to deepening our faith. As we engage with the Word, we encounter the very thoughts, teachings, and heart of God Himself. The Scriptures reveal His character, His promises, and His faithfulness throughout history. Through study, we develop a more profound trust in His sovereignty and growing confidence in His plans for our lives.

Spiritual Growth

Bible study is an essential catalyst for spiritual growth. As we immerse ourselves in Scripture, we encounter transformative stories of faith, examples of God’s miraculous work, and lessons from the lives of biblical figures. These narratives become a source of inspiration and guidance, shaping our character and molding us into the likeness of Christ.

Additionally, the Bible confronts our shortcomings, challenges our beliefs, and convicts us of areas in need of growth. It serves as a mirror that reflects our true selves, allowing us to confront our flaws and align our lives with God’s truth.

7 Personal Benefits of Bible Study

1. Spiritual Nourishment

Just as our bodies require nourishment to thrive, our spirits also need sustenance to flourish. Bible study acts as a spiritual feast, offering us the sustenance we need to grow closer to God. Within its pages, we find words of comfort, encouragement, and hope. It satisfies our spiritual hunger and quenches our thirst for meaning and purpose.

Through the study of Scripture, we partake in the wisdom and truth that emanate from God Himself. As Jesus declared,

“Man shall not live by bread alone, but by every word that proceeds out of the mouth of God” (Matthew 4:4, ESV).

Bible study provides the sustenance our souls require to thrive, nourishing us with divine insight, guidance, and transformation.

2. Connection with God

Bible study is a pathway to intimacy and connection with God. As we immerse ourselves in His Word, we encounter His character, His love, and His divine plan for humanity. The Scriptures reveal His heart and His desires for a relationship with us.

In the process of studying the Bible, we open ourselves to encountering the living God. Through prayerful reflection and meditation on His Word, we invite His presence into our lives. The Holy Spirit works through the Scriptures to illuminate our understanding, speak to our hearts, and draw us closer to God Himself.

Bible study becomes a sacred space where we engage in a dialogue with the Creator. It is through this dialogue that we deepen our relationship with Him, learning to listen, obey, and align our lives with His will.

3. Wisdom for Decision-Making

Life is filled with choices, and making wise decisions is crucial. Bible study offers us a wealth of wisdom to navigate the complexities of life. Through the stories, teachings, and principles within Scripture, we gain insights into God’s character and His ways. As we study the Word, we acquire discernment and develop a biblical framework for making decisions that align with God’s will.

The book of Proverbs, for instance, abounds with practical wisdom for various aspects of life, including relationships, finances, work, and character development. Bible study allows us to tap into this treasury of wisdom and apply it to our daily choices.

4. Guidance in Times of Difficulty

Life’s challenges often leave us feeling lost, overwhelmed, or uncertain. Bible study serves as a compass, offering guidance and hope in the midst of trials. Through the experiences of individuals in the Bible, we discover how God has worked in similar situations, providing comfort, strength, and guidance.

The Psalms, in particular, contain expressions of human emotion, including anguish, fear, and despair, while also highlighting the unwavering faithfulness of God. As we study these passages, we find solace and encouragement, knowing that we are not alone in our struggles and that God is with us every step of the way.

5. Principles for Character Development

Bible study helps shape our character, molding us into people of integrity, compassion, and love. It presents us with models of exemplary character and reveals the transformative power of God’s grace in the lives of flawed individuals.

By studying the life of Jesus and the teachings of the New Testament, we learn valuable lessons about humility, forgiveness, perseverance, and servant leadership. Bible study challenges us to examine our own lives and align our character with the virtues and values espoused in Scripture.

6. Renewing the Mind

Bible study has the capacity to renew our minds and transform our thought patterns. As we immerse ourselves in the truths of Scripture, we are exposed to God’s perspective on life, relationships, morality, and purpose. The Word challenges our preconceived notions and worldly philosophies, inviting us to adopt a biblical worldview.

The apostle Paul exhorted believers to be transformed by the renewing of their minds (Romans 12:2). Through Bible study, we replace worldly thinking with God’s wisdom, gaining a renewed understanding of ourselves, others, and the world around us.

7. Shaping Attitudes and Emotions

The Scriptures have a profound impact on our attitudes and emotions. As we study and meditate on God’s Word, His truth permeates our hearts, shaping our attitudes and molding our emotional responses. The promises, encouragement, and admonitions found within the Bible have the power to uplift us, fill us with hope, and anchor us in times of distress.

Bible study exposes us to the character of God and His unchanging love for His creation. This knowledge cultivates gratitude, humility, compassion, and forgiveness within us. As we encounter God’s grace and mercy, our hearts are softened, leading to a transformation of our attitudes and emotional well-being.

Equipping Oneself to Share the Gospel Effectively

Bible study not only transforms our own lives but also equips us to effectively share the Gospel with others. It provides us with a deep understanding of God’s redemptive plan and empowers us to communicate His message of love, grace, and salvation to a world in need.

Understanding God’s Redemptive Plan

Through Bible study, we gain a comprehensive understanding of God’s redemptive plan for humanity. We encounter the narrative of creation, the fall of humanity, and God’s relentless pursuit of reconciliation through Jesus Christ. The Scriptures unveil the depth of God’s love and the significance of Christ’s sacrifice on the cross.

By immersing ourselves in the Word, we grasp the theological foundations of salvation, forgiveness, and eternal life. This understanding enables us to effectively communicate the Gospel message, emphasizing its relevance and life-transforming power.

Sharing God’s Truth with Clarity

Bible study enables us to articulate the Gospel with clarity and conviction. As we delve into the Scriptures, we uncover the key teachings, principles, and essential doctrines that underpin our faith. This knowledge equips us to explain foundational concepts such as sin, repentance, faith, and the person and work of Jesus Christ.

Addressing Questions and Objections

Bible study equips us to engage in thoughtful conversations and address questions and objections regarding the Christian faith. Through diligent study, we develop a deeper understanding of the Scriptures and the ability to provide reasoned and well-informed responses to doubts, skepticism, and theological inquiries.

As we study the Word, we encounter passages that address common objections and concerns raised by skeptics or seekers. This knowledge allows us to engage in respectful dialogue, providing thoughtful answers and pointing to the truth found in Scripture.
